AIG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

838 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in American International (AIG)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$42.4B — down 1.2% from $43B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 116 funds closed out of AIG and 61 opened new positions — a net loss of 55 holders — while 368 trimmed existing stakes and 254 added.

The largest buyer was Macquarie Group, adding an estimated $687M. The largest seller was Franklin Resources, cutting an estimated $216M.
